31. What is Scroll Versions about?
• Version management
• Manage multiple versions in a single space
• Work in parallel with the software development process
• Keep pace with the development team
• Use Confluence as a documentation platform
• One system fits all, Confluence as the only platform
• Publish content with a few clicks
• Have pages with the same page title within a single space
• Manage different product variants on the space level

37. Version concept
• A Version is a collection of page edits that can be published at the same time
• Versions can reflect the actual versions of your product release cycle
• Every version inherits the edits made in previous, dependent versions
• no manual content copy needed, only make actual changes
